What makes something count as medical malpractice?Not each bad outcome qualifies as malpractice. To pursue a case, you will need to prove four things: there was a duty of care, the provider deviated from the accepted clinical guidelines, that deviation caused your injury, and that real, measurable damages resulted. How many months or years should I expect this process to last?Medical malpractice cases are among the most complex to resolve in personal injury law. A straightforward case may conclude in 12 to 18 months, while more complex matters can last several years. Variables including the availability of expert witnesses all impact the schedule.
How long do I have to file a malpractice claim in California?In California, the time limit for medical malpractice is typically three years after the negligent act or twelve months after you found out about the injury, whichever comes first. Exceptions exist for patients who were underage at the time. Time is critical — failing to file in time destroys your right to compensation.
What compensation is available in a malpractice lawsuit?Victims may be entitled to a range of damages in a successful malpractice claim. These generally cover current and ongoing treatment costs, income lost during recovery, physical discomfort and emotional distress, and in cases of extreme negligence, you could receive punitive compensation as well. California places limits on non-economic damages in malpractice cases, which is yet another factor to have a knowledgeable medical malpractice lawyer in your corner.
